]> git.proxmox.com Git - pve-manager.git/commitdiff
copy form/BusTypeSelector.js from manager to manager5
authorDietmar Maurer <dietmar@proxmox.com>
Fri, 3 Jul 2015 09:29:11 +0000 (11:29 +0200)
committerDietmar Maurer <dietmar@proxmox.com>
Fri, 3 Jul 2015 09:29:11 +0000 (11:29 +0200)
www/manager5/form/BusTypeSelector.js [new file with mode: 0644]

diff --git a/www/manager5/form/BusTypeSelector.js b/www/manager5/form/BusTypeSelector.js
new file mode 100644 (file)
index 0000000..00f8281
--- /dev/null
@@ -0,0 +1,24 @@
+Ext.define('PVE.form.BusTypeSelector', {
+    extend: 'PVE.form.KVComboBox',
+    alias: ['widget.PVE.form.BusTypeSelector'],
+  
+    noVirtIO: false,
+
+    noScsi: false,
+
+    initComponent: function() {
+       var me = this;
+
+       me.data = [['ide', 'IDE'], ['sata', 'SATA']];
+
+       if (!me.noVirtIO) {
+           me.data.push(['virtio', 'VIRTIO']);
+       }
+
+       if (!me.noScsi) {
+           me.data.push(['scsi', 'SCSI']);
+       }
+
+       me.callParent();
+    }
+});